What is the difference between visible light and x rays

Respuesta :

l4ladri l4ladri
  • 01-10-2020

Answer: X rays are high energy electromagnetic waves, but visible light is medium energy electromagnetic waves.

The visible spectrum is very narrow compared to the X-ray spectrum.

X rays can penetrate the human body but visible light is not capable of doing that. Hope this helped! :)
